Best Welder in Washington County

Slinger high school welder Rachel Hau

Moraine Park held a welding competition at our Jackson Campus, Friday, Dec. 2 for high school students.  The event, hosted by our Welding Program, had participants from West Bend and Slinger high schools locate and cut a hole, put the parts together to match a print, then weld them per print.  The students could pick either GMAW, SMAW, or both.

GMAW is gas metal arc welding, and SMAW is Shielded metal arc welding.

Moraine Park driver wins Kulwicki Cup, $54,439

Kulwicki race car driver holding winning flag

Alex Prunty, a Moraine Park Technical College alumnus and 24-year-old rising racing star from Lomira, Wisconsin, has won the 2016 “Kulwicki Cup” Championship. That announcement from officials at Kulwicki Driver Development Program (KDDP) came the day before Thanksgiving.

Prunty won the title by eight points (533-525) over New England standout Dave Farrington, Jr., from Jay, Maine.

Coffee, hot chocolate and cookies? Yes, please!

Male and female Moraine Park students creating gift baskets

Comfort Cups “N” Sweets is a business started by 14 students in the Business Practice Firm class at Moraine Park Technical College. This class is required in the Administrative Professional, Business Management, and Human Resource Programs. The class provides students with real life experience and utilizes the skills they’ve acquired throughout their program.
